Army captures ‘Cuchillo’s’ #2

The Colombian army captured the second-in-command to paramilitary drug lord “El Cuchillo,” who is one of the country’s most wanted fugitives, reports Caracol Radio.

The 8th Brigade of the army’s 18th Division nabbed Jose Manuel Capera Oyola, alias “Nube Negra,” in the town of Arauca in the Vichada department.

Investigators, who had been tracking Nube Negra for over a year, say that the paramilitary fighter was planning an attack when he was captured.

Nube Negra demobilized as a member of the AUC in April 2006, but has continued to be part of criminal gangs. He was wanted by the Colombian authorities for terrorism, murder, kidnapping and extortion.

Colombian authorities are closing in on El Cuchillo, as this latest capture follows the arrests of the gang’s “financial muscle” in October, and its chief hitman in August.
